Mybatis如何在插入语句执行后直接将主键返回
1、假如数据库中有如下学生信息表,其中ID为主键,类型为Number。T_STUDENT_INFO表对应的实体对象为StudentInfoBean


2、通过@ModelAtrribute给初始化一个StudentInfoBean实体对象,对象的name为zhangsan

1、通过语句studentInfoBeanMapper.insert(student)执行插入操作

2、以下sql代码是由Mybatis Generator自动生成的,用于向T_STUDENT_INFO中插入一条记录

3、给主键ID创建一个序列idseq,创建语句如下:
create sequence idseq
increment by 1
start with 1
maxvalue 999999999;

4、在Sql语句中添加语句用于生成主键并将生成的主键返回给StudentInfoBean对象,执行【栏目二】【步骤1】中的插入语句后可以看到生成的主键ID自动返回到了student对象中。



声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
                                阅读量:101
阅读量:30
阅读量:129
阅读量:100
阅读量:87